CHARACTERS (Our "family" of immigrants heading west. We'll Have to pretend what our background is first.)

Backgrounds; Banker, Blacksmith, Carpenter, Doctor, Farmer, Merchant, saddle maker, Teacher.

That goes from the highest amount of starting money, banker, who starts with $1600 to lowest, teacher, who has $400. Obviously how hard the game will be is quite apparent, as a teacher, cause we'll have zilch for starting money!
